'Naked' Scanner in Airport Trial

"A trial of a scanner that produces "naked" images of passengers has begun at Manchester Airport.

Sarah Barrett, head of customer experience at the airport, said most passengers did not like the traditional "pat down" search.

At Manchester Airport's Terminal 2, where the machine has been introduced, passengers will no longer have to remove their coats, shoes and belts as they go through security checks.

Ms Barrett said: "This scanner completely takes away the hassle of needing to undress."

Ms Barrett said the black-and-white image would only be seen by one officer in a remote location before it was deleted.

"The images are not erotic or pornographic and they cannot be stored or captured in any way," she said.

Passengers could refuse to be scanned, she added."
